TOPCon Solar Module: India's Growing Leader in Output
India’s photovoltaic sector is witnessing a notable shift towards Tunnel Oxide Passivated Contact panel technology. These innovative systems offer improved performance compared to traditional Passivated Emitter and Rear Cell units, making them increasingly desirable to investors. The smaller cost per watt, coupled with increased reliability in hot conditions – a essential factor for the Indian climate – is driving rapid adoption. Consequently, TOP Con panel producers are growing their presence in the country, signaling a bright prospect for solar energy in India.

The TOPCon vs. PERC: Which PV Module Approach Prevails in India?
The landscape for solar modules in India is undergoing a major shift. For a long time, PERC (Passivated Emitter and Rear Cell) technology has been the primary choice, delivering a reasonable balance of cost and output. However, TOPCon (Tunnel Oxide Passivated Contact) steadily gaining traction. Although PERC remains competitive, TOPCon’s intrinsic higher performance characteristics and potential for greater improvement are leading to it an more desirable option for manufacturers and consumers alike. In conclusion, the future of the Indian solar space will probably be shaped by the persistent competition and developments in both these important technologies, with TOPCon positioned to potentially take a larger share.
